History of Ethereum
Launched in July 2015, Ethereum was created by Vitalik Buterin, a Russian-Canadian programmer. The platform was designed to address the limitations of Bitcoin, which was primarily focused on digital currency transactions. Ethereum aimed to create a decentralized platform that could support the development of DApps and smart contracts, allowing developers to build innovative applications without the need for intermediaries.
Technology Behind Ethereum
Ethereum operates on a blockchain, which is a decentralized ledger that records all transactions across a network of computers. The Ethereum blockchain is powered by its native cryptocurrency, ETH. Here are some key technologies that make Ethereum unique:
-
Smart Contracts: These are self-executing contracts with the terms of the agreement directly written into lines of code. They automatically enforce and execute the terms of an agreement, eliminating the need for intermediaries.
-
Decentralized Applications (DApps): These are applications that run on a blockchain and operate independently of any single entity. DApps can be used for a wide range of purposes, from decentralized finance (DeFi) to decentralized identity (DID).
-
Gas: Ethereum uses a resource-based fee structure called gas, which is required to execute transactions and run smart contracts. Gas is paid in ETH and is used to incentivize miners to process transactions.
-
Proof of Work (PoW) and Proof of Stake (PoS): Ethereum initially used PoW for consensus, but it is transitioning to PoS, which is expected to be more energy-efficient and secure.

Use Cases of Ethereum
Ethereum has a wide range of use cases, thanks to its smart contract and DApp capabilities. Here are some of the most notable applications:
-
Decentralized Finance (DeFi): DeFi platforms allow users to access financial services without the need for traditional intermediaries, such as banks. Ethereum has become the leading platform for DeFi applications.
